From 0599574260c130641aaf6115c77cf9fe98747b42 Mon Sep 17 00:00:00 2001 From: Chris Mason Date: Fri, 11 Sep 2009 11:25:02 -0400 Subject: [PATCH] --- yaml --- r: 165887 b: refs/heads/master c: e48c465bb366c0169f7908bfe62ae7080874ee7d h: refs/heads/master i: 165885: 7afe8271028142c5e497ebb8f63777c761dd87bc 165883: daefc84b89b836e1879e088bae21d63645859b89 165879: b2319e47500f6223e4250ed886ec95cbfb9591f3 165871: df1b0ca5681fc3e68de05b5e2732b15afdaf2764 165855: 9d78fc877349052bc735df94c08dfe495b3d688d 165823: 04c5343887f5e196c7eed984ba961c0041809aa5 165759: 6116f0948509fcd794cb963a631e4ef33a81ab87 165631: ac58b482f11a5aac31b81e30b2ef4bddd6bafe3d 165375: f5d0b400dafbcd03b682d82c569ed89b7bd74806 164863: 2e05ccbbf71351aebbc2ab5976b95343b41d6c15 163839: 820908f85d8f79136026e16e4e366ec7895ebcf6 v: v3 --- [refs] | 2 +- trunk/fs/btrfs/extent_io.c |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/[refs] b/[refs] index ac92b6dbd691..d225fe849465 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 890871be854b5f5e43e7ba2475f706209906cc24 +refs/heads/master: e48c465bb366c0169f7908bfe62ae7080874ee7d diff --git a/trunk/fs/btrfs/extent_io.c b/trunk/fs/btrfs/extent_io.c index 41cf1b451b41..8e168a457a37 100644 --- a/trunk/fs/btrfs/extent_io.c +++ b/trunk/fs/btrfs/extent_io.c @@ -367,10 +367,10 @@ static int insert_state(struct extent_io_tree *tree, } if (bits & EXTENT_DIRTY) tree->dirty_bytes += end - start + 1; - set_state_cb(tree, state, bits); - state->state |= bits; state->start = start; state->end = end; + set_state_cb(tree, state, bits); + state->state |= bits; node = tree_insert(&tree->state, end, &state->rb_node); if (node) { struct extent_state *found;